Default Cooperative Aldi Price List

If you've come across my blog, you've noticed I'm on kind of an Aldi kick. I know I save money by going there, and it can save time over chasing sales and using coupons. I recently read where some people use Aldi prices as a baseline in their price book, so they know when a sale someplace else is really worthwhile. Sounded like a good idea to me.

But I figured, why should so many people be duplicating the effort? Why not an Aldi price book online, where lots of people could add prices for missing products, and also have access to the info other people have already posted?

So I started a "social spreadsheet" here. It's free to join, then you can add to it. Just an experiment, but maybe it will turn out to be useful...
